1. Set Clear Goals: Begin your Spanish journey by defining clear and achievable goals. Whether you aim to hold basic conversations, navigate travel situations, or delve into Spanish literature, establishing your objectives will provide a roadmap for your learning adventure.

2. Start with the Basics: Build a solid foundation by mastering fundamental concepts such as greetings, numbers, and common phrases. Focus on pronunciation and basic grammar rules to establish a strong base for your language skills.

3. Immerse Yourself in Spanish Media: Expose yourself to the rhythm and melody of the Spanish language through music, movies, and podcasts. This immersive approach enhances your listening skills, expands your vocabulary, and familiarizes you with various Spanish accents.

4. Use Language Learning Apps: Incorporate language learning apps into your daily routine. Platforms like Duolingo, Memrise, and Babbel offer interactive lessons, vocabulary practice, and fun challenges, making your learning experience both engaging and effective.

5. Practice Regularly: Consistency is key! Dedicate a set amount of time each day to practice Spanish. Whether through flashcards, language exchange, or daily conversations with native speakers, regular practice accelerates your language acquisition.

6. Join Language Learning Communities: Connect with fellow language enthusiasts in online communities or local meetups. Engaging with others who share your passion for learning Spanish provides valuable support, motivation, and opportunities for practice.

7. Take Formal Classes or Hire a Tutor: Consider enrolling in a formal Spanish course or hiring a tutor for personalized guidance. Structured lessons and direct feedback from an instructor can accelerate your learning and address specific challenges.

8. Embrace Cultural Learning: Explore the rich tapestry of Spanish-speaking cultures. Learn about traditions, customs, and celebrations to deepen your connection with the language. This cultural understanding enhances your overall language proficiency.

9. Track Your Progress: Keep a language learning journal or use tracking tools to monitor your progress. Celebrate milestones, reflect on challenges, and adjust your approach as needed to ensure a continuous and enjoyable learning experience.
